Output d98072350d045978db55c28e3819f0692d69673ebcfd34cd68e31dfd3a9de078:66

value
35500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e64eb305fdecddcabbdff7bbacb2886b546eae19 OP_EQUAL
address
3NgmcnhPQudk7YUhuYb2LYLUmny4LhRna6
transaction
d98072350d045978db55c28e3819f0692d69673ebcfd34cd68e31dfd3a9de078
confirmations
255103
spent
true